Emulation of LocalFileSystem with virtual COM.

Dependencies:   USBDevice

Dependents:   KL46Z-lpc81isp lpcterm2

#include "USBLocalFileSystem.h"

int main() {
    USBLocalFileSystem* usb_local = new USBLocalFileSystem(); // RamDisk(64KB)

    while(1) {
        usb_local->lock(true);
        usb_local->remount();
        char filename[32];
        if (usb_local->find(filename, sizeof(filename), "*.TXT")) {
            FILE* fp = fopen(filename, "r");
            if (fp) {
                int c;
                while((c = fgetc(fp)) != EOF) {
                    usb_local->putc(c);
                }
                fclose(fp);
            }
        }    
        usb_local->lock(false);

        wait_ms(1000*5);
    }
}

#pragma once

#include "USBHID_Types.h"
#include "USBDevice.h"

#define HID_EPINT_IN   EP4IN
#define HID_EPINT_OUT  EP4OUT

/** USB HID device for CMSIS-DAP
 */
class USB_HID {
public:

    /**
    * Constructor
    *
    * @param output_report_length Maximum length of a sent report (up to 64 bytes) (default: 64 bytes)
    * @param input_report_length Maximum length of a received report (up to 64 bytes) (default: 64 bytes)
    */
    USB_HID(USBDevice* device, uint8_t output_report_length = 64, uint8_t input_report_length = 64);


    /**
    * Send a Report. warning: blocking
    *
    * @param report Report which will be sent (a report is defined by all data and the length)
    * @returns true if successful
    */
    bool send(HID_REPORT *report);
    
    
    /**
    * Send a Report. warning: non blocking
    *
    * @param report Report which will be sent (a report is defined by all data and the length)
    * @returns true if successful
    */
    bool sendNB(HID_REPORT *report);
    
    /**
    * Read a report: blocking
    *
    * @param report pointer to the report to fill
    * @returns true if successful
    */
    bool read(HID_REPORT * report);
    
    /**
    * Read a report: non blocking
    *
    * @param report pointer to the report to fill
    * @returns true if successful
    */
    bool readNB(HID_REPORT * report);

    /*
    * Get the length of the report descriptor
    *
    * @returns the length of the report descriptor
    */
    virtual uint16_t reportDescLength();

    bool Request_callback(CONTROL_TRANSFER* transfer, uint8_t* hidDescriptor);
protected:
    /*
    * Get the Report descriptor
    *
    * @returns pointer to the report descriptor
    */
    virtual uint8_t * reportDesc();

    uint16_t reportLength;

private:
    USBDevice* _device;
    HID_REPORT outputReport;
    uint8_t output_length;
    uint8_t input_length;
};
